St. Simon of Crépy

Reconciler of Kings

Current Church statusSaint
Feast / commemorationSeptember 3
Remembered asReconciler of Kings
BirthplaceCrépy, France
Country / regionFrance
Period1048-1082

Life and historical setting

Simon of Crépy (1048-1082) is remembered in the Church as reconciler of Kings. The supplied Catholic source associates this life with Crépy, France.
